Output d524bbe40df225091faf2e311cb1e3390e156bddbbc5acc629ddffff04b7b1ee:0

value
639048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66829a443158729d42d70ad440538b25ef4f076f OP_EQUAL
address
3B33JYBSBgkuTv9cBvZsqp7M8fp18NBMNT
transaction
d524bbe40df225091faf2e311cb1e3390e156bddbbc5acc629ddffff04b7b1ee
confirmations
163877
spent
true